Coke is generally formed by destructive distillation of coal, has a higher Carbon content, and it finds use mainly in Steel manufacturing in blast furnaces. Although there are other sources of energy like petroleum and natural gas, the advantage that Coal offers relative to them is its ease of combustion and the high calorific/heat value ...

ISO 18283 does not include sampling of brown coals and lignites, which is described in ISO 5069-1 and ISO 5069-2, nor sampling from coal seams, for which guidance is given in ISO 14180. Mechanical sampling of coal and coke is covered in ISO 13909 (all parts).

Coal is the mainstay of India's economy, with more than 55% of the national energy requirement (Singh, 2008) being met by combustion in power plants with capacities of 30–500 MW across the country.Energy deficit is a perennial problem of the country and progressively more thermal coals will be utilized to meet India's energy requirements.
